1. Circuit Board
The circuit board of an air conditioner is very small, but crucial piece of equipment that controls the heating and cooling system. The circuit board gets data from temperature sensors and thermostats which then cycle the compressor to turn off or on in order to preserve the temperature you want to maintain.
The board can also carry out various other functions, such as keeping error codes in memory and conducting security checks to make sure that every connection is functioning correctly. The majority of modern AC units are equipped with a control board that can automatically scan all the units and identify any issue.
The panel will flash an alert code to the homeowner when it notices any issues. This allows them to identify the source of the problem and prevent further harm.
The problem usually is caused by poor solder connections. Plugs with stems may be damaged because they are soldered incorrectly to the circuit made of metal. The expansion of heat can cause joints to shift shape and even cause gap.
First thing you need to look into if your circuit board does not work is the power source. Circuit boards require electricity to function. This can be drawn by line voltage or a control transformer.
Test your circuit board by connecting a tester to the power source. It is done through plugging in the Molex plug, and then connecting the wires that are low voltage with meter leads.
The reading of 24 Volts signifies that the circuit board is powered enough to work properly. If you don't get 24 volts, it may indicate an issue with your wiring or transformer. Therefore, it is recommended to have an expert examine your circuit board.

3. Evaporator
The evaporator coil is a essential component of any air conditioner that helps to remove heat from the indoor air. It works in conjunction alongside the condenser unit to complete the process of heat exchange and create cool air.
The refrigerant is cold when it enters the evaporator coil and absorbs energy from the air that is in the home while it moves through it. After the refrigerant absorbs all of the heat from your home, it passes through the condenser coil in your outdoor and then releases it to the outdoors air.
When your coil inside is clean and free from dirt, dust, and grime, it's going to improve its efficiency in the removal of heat. This allows the device to function more efficiently, which saves you the cost of energy.
However, even a tiny amount of dirt or dust could be harmful to your evaporator coil's ability to absorb and transfer heat. This could affect the performance of your system because it doesn't allow the refrigeration fluids from absorption of enough heat.
Another issue that can affect the evaporator coil is contamination. When dormant airborne mold spores come into contact with the surfaces of your evaporator coils which have been wet from condensation, they begin to grow.

4. Compressor
The compressor is the center of any air conditioner. Therefore, its failure is likely to be the costliest component to repair. The cost of compressor repair will vary based on the type of the problem and whether the compressor is under warranty.
Refrigerant leaks are the most common cause of a compressor failure. Leaks can cause a number of issues including insufficient cooling and frequent cycling.
Filters that are dirty or clogged may create AC compressors to fail. Filters that are dirty hinder the circulation of cool air and lower efficiency. Filters also allow contaminants to pass through the air vents, as well as in the air that you take in.
It is crucial to clean your air filter on a regular basis to prevent dust, dirt and other particles from accumulating. This will also prevent the leakage of refrigerant, and will let your compressor work efficiently.
Compressors may be affected by malfunctioning thermostats, or if the compressor is shut down. If your unit has begun to leak refrigerant it might have to be repaired.
